Power Lines & Dream Power: Unpacking the Pylon's Cultural Charge

What does an electric pylon really symbolize? It's more than just a metal structure.

Consider its imposing height. A silent giant against the sky.

Think about its function. Delivering power, connecting disparate points.

Historically, electricity itself was revolutionary. A symbol of progress. Of modernity.

Early 20th-century imagery often depicted pylons as monuments to technological advancement. A sign of a bright future.

But pylons can also represent intrusion. A disruption of the natural landscape.

Some might see them as eyesores. Marring the beauty of nature.

This duality is key. Progress vs. disruption. Modernity vs. nature.

Consider the location in your dream. A rural setting? A bustling city? This context matters.

Is the pylon standing alone? Or part of a network? This affects the interpretation.

Does it feel threatening, or simply a part of the background? The emotion is crucial.

The cultural perspective of the pylon is multifaceted. It changes with time and place.

It is a symbol both celebrated and criticized. A reflection of our complex relationship with technology.

Ultimately, the pylon in your dream speaks to your own relationship with progress, power, and the environment. What does it say to you?
